Motocaddy M7 GPS Electric Golf Caddie: Going the Distance

February 22, 2023No Comments4 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r WhatsApp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n WhatsApp Pinterest Email

Employing a caddie has long been a luxury the average golfer can’t afford. Imagine the difference in your game if you had someone (or something) to carry your bag and give you precise yardages.

Game changer!

The leader in electric trolleys and golf push carts has revealed its biggest innovation yet. Introducing the Motocaddy M7 GPS, the first electric golf caddie to feature a fully integrated touchscreen GPS unit.

The all-new M7 GPS promises the “ultimate caddie experience” by striking a perfect balance of premium features and functionality. Let’s take a closer look at this innovative electric golf caddie design and learn more about how it improves on the beloved Motocaddy M7 REMOTE.

Motocaddy M7 GPS Availability and Pricing

  • Available now
  • Retail is $1,899
  • Free 12-month trial of Motocaddy’s Performance Plan included with purchase ($69.99 to renew)

What’s New?

Motocaddy M7 GPS remote

What good is a caddie if they can’t give you fast, accurate yardages? The M7 GPS is fittingly named for its fully integrated GPS touchscreen. Pre-loaded with nearly 40,000 courses, the GPS gives you the distances to the front, middle and back of the green as well as useful hazard information.

The GPS system is housed within a crystal-clear 3.5-inch LCD touchscreen display that is useable in all weather conditions and with a glove. In addition to its distance-calculating capabilities, the unit also provides a round timer, shot measurement, automatic hole advancement, score tracking and a battery indicator.

Leave the rangefinder at home—the M7 GPS provides an all-in-one experience without the need for extra gear.

“It offers everything a golfer needs to transport their clubs around the course effortlessly while providing pinpoint yardages and
GPS mapping through its super-responsive touchscreen,” said Motocaddy Marketing Director Oliver Churcher. “The revolutionary GPS technology pioneered by Motocaddy in 2017 has advanced a great deal in recent years. Today, our cellular-powered Performance Plan combines with the most responsive remote-control technology on the market to take the trolley experience to an exciting new level.”

Performance Plan

Golfers who seek increased functionality and extra goodies will love the Motocaddy Performance Plan. A free 12-month trial of the Performance Plan is included with your purchase of the M7 GPS. This unique add-on harnesses cellular connectivity to unlock useful game-management features. The Performance Plan includes access to hole-mapping capabilities, a dynamic view of the green (to aid in green-reading), statistic tracking, performance analysis and more.

Annual renewal of the Performance Plan costs $69 USD.

Carry Companion

Motocaddy M7 GPS with bag

At its heart, the Motocaddy M7 GPS is an electric push cart (or trolley). If it can’t nail this function, it renders the GPS rather meaningless. Thankfully, the M7 GPS is more than a capable carry companion. Here’s what you need to know:

  • Powered by a 28.8-volt system with a rechargeable lithium battery
  • Equipped with a wider wheel base to handle all types of terrain
  • Nine speed settings
  • Automatic Downhill Control technology
  • Remote control functionality for a “hands-free” experience
  • EASILOCK bag-to-cart connection
  • Compact folding design for easy transportation and storage
